Definition
A commissionaire is a person employed to greet and assist guests or visitors, often in a hotel or public venue.
Sample Sentences
- The commissionaire greeted the guests with a warm smile as they entered the grand hotel.
- In the bustling marketplace, the commissionaire helped direct tourists to the best local shops.
- After securing the job, he found that being a commissionaire was both exciting and demanding.
- The commissionaire stood by the entrance, ensuring that only authorized personnel could enter the building.
- Her role as a commissionaire required not only good communication skills but also a keen sense of security.
